Deer Reportedly Causes Motorcycle Crash

The rider was injured in the crash near Dillsboro.

(Dillsboro, Ind.) - Emergency crews are on the scene of a motorcycle crash near Dillsboro Friday midday.

It was about 11:30 a.m. when police and EMTs were dispatched to a reported collision between a motorcycle and a deer. It happened in the 15600 block of Sangamaw Road.

The rider was injured, but its unclear how seriously.
